New Jersey market notes for Wegovy (semaglutide)

For Wegovy (semaglutide, weight-management NDC) in New Jersey, expect BMI/comorbidity PA and more frequent obesity carve-outs than diabetes Ozempic — list prices look similar, coverage does not. New Jersey’s dense pharmacy competition can lower cash Ozempic quotes versus nearby New York City retail, but many employer plans still force mail-order specialty for brand GLP-1s. Prior auth packets that omit sleep apnea, hypertension, or documented lifestyle attempts are frequent denial triggers. If you commute across state lines for care, make sure the prescribing state and pharmacy network match your plan’s rules.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much does Wegovy (semaglutide) cost in New Jersey without insurance?

List price in New Jersey is about $1,430/month. Cash discount programs may reduce cost to $370–$529/month; compounded semaglutide runs $211–$423/month via telehealth.

Does insurance cover Wegovy (semaglutide) in New Jersey?

Novo Nordisk markets Wegovy for chronic weight management. Commercial plans often require prior authorization; Medicare coverage depends on indication. See our <a href="/guides/glp1-prior-authorization/" class="text-accent-400 underline">prior auth guide</a>.
